Best Digital Products to Sell Online and Actually Make Money in 2026

 


Not all digital products are created equal. While the promise of passive income from selling digital products online is real, your success depends enormously on what you choose to sell. The best digital products to sell online in 2026 share three traits: they solve a clear problem, they have proven demand, and they can be created once and sold repeatedly.

Here are the most profitable digital product categories to consider for your online business this year.




1. Online Courses and Workshops




Online courses remain the highest-earning category in the digital product space. If you have expertise in any area — fitness, finance, marketing, cooking, coding, photography, or language learning — you can package that knowledge into a structured course and sell it for anywhere from $27 to $2,000+.

Platforms like Teachable, Kajabi, and Thinkific make it straightforward to host and sell courses without technical expertise. The key to a profitable course is specificity — "How to Get Your First 1,000 Instagram Followers as a Food Blogger" will outsell "Instagram Marketing" every time.




2. Printable Templates and Planners




Printable products are among the easiest digital items to create and sell. Budget planners, wedding checklists, meal prep templates, business invoice templates, and classroom resources sell consistently on Etsy with minimal ongoing effort.

Tools like Canva make professional-quality template design accessible to anyone, regardless of design background. With the right SEO on your Etsy listings, printables can generate reliable passive income month after month.




3. eBooks and Digital Guides




eBooks have experienced a significant resurgence. Short, highly specific guides — often just 20 to 50 pages — that solve one problem thoroughly are especially popular. Topics with strong demand include personal finance, fitness, relationships, career development, and business strategy.

Price your eBook between $9 and $37 for best conversion, and use platforms like Gumroad or your own website to retain maximum profit.




4. Canva and Design Templates

Businesses, bloggers, and social media managers are constantly in need of professionally designed templates they can customize quickly. Instagram post templates, media kit templates, pitch deck designs, and logo kits are in high demand and command strong prices.




If you have a good design eye, this is one of the fastest-growing niches in the digital product market.




5. Stock Photos, Video, and Music




If you're a photographer, videographer, or musician, your existing creative work can become a long-term revenue stream. Upload to platforms like Shutterstock, Adobe Stock, or Pond5, or sell directly through your own site. High-quality niche content — food photography, small business lifestyle shots, or lo-fi background music — performs particularly well.




6. Software, Plugins, and Digital Tools

For developers and technical creators, software tools, WordPress plugins, Notion templates, and spreadsheet systems represent some of the highest-margin digital products available. A well-built Notion productivity system or Excel budget tracker can sell for $15–$100 and requires no ongoing fulfillment.






Choosing What to Sell

The best digital product for your business is the one that aligns with your existing skills and serves a clearly defined audience. Don't try to sell everything — start with one product, build your audience around it, and expand your product range as your business grows.

In 2026, the opportunity to build a profitable online digital product selling business is greater than ever. The tools are accessible, the platforms are established, and the global appetite for digital solutions shows no sign of slowing. All that's missing is your first product.
